Effects of Counterions and Solvents on Properties of Meso\|tetraphenylporphyrin Aggregate by Spectral Methods

Abstract:

The effects of  acids (HCl,H2SO4,HBr and HNO3) on meso\|tetraphenylporphyrin (H2TPP) in dichloromethanesolution were investigated by means of   UV/Vis absorption combined with Raman scattering techniques, the electronic absorption spectrum shows the J\|aggregate of H2TPP is formed in the presence of HCl, HBr or HNO3, but both of H\| and J\|aggregates are formed in the presence of H2SO4 characteristic double bands at 818/834 cm-1and 1 072/1 093 cm-1 represented the main vibrational frequency difference between H\| and J\|aggregates.  Raman spectra of aggregate H2TPP in the presence H2SO4 in dichloromethane, toluene and chloroform solutions show the dependence of aggregation behavior on the nature of solvent. The conclusion is that H2TPP diacid has a tendency to form J\|aggregate in high solubility solvents, but both H\| and J\|types of aggregates in the relative low solubility ones.
